Traditional braces involve the fixing of small brackets to a patient’s teeth. The brackets are joined by wires, and slowly alter the alignment of teeth within the mouth. The procedure is usually done for cosmetic purposes, and can take anywhere from 12 to 36 months, depending on the degree of correction required.

The appearance of braces, along with the time taken to complete treatment, has long been considered one of the drawbacks of this approach. The Invisalign devices now offered by Schacher Orthodontics seek to address many of these concerns. Consisting of a clear plastic mold that fits over teeth, they are more aesthetically pleasing and, in some cases, can produce results more quickly.

While Dr. Schacher agrees that clear aligners are useful for some patients, the orthodontist stresses that the devices might not be suitable in all cases. Traditional braces cause teeth to move at a ‘bodily’ level. This means that the teeth actually move through the bone to their new position. In comparison, clear aligners ‘tip’ teeth, so while the angle of the teeth might be changed, their actual location within the bone is not.
